TOP
0
0
【23號簡體館日】限時三天領券享優惠!!
SQL Server實用教程2016(第5版)(簡體書)
滿額折

SQL Server實用教程2016(第5版)(簡體書)

人民幣定價:59 元
定  價:NT$ 354 元
優惠價:87308
領券後再享88折
海外經銷商無庫存,到貨日平均30天至45天
可得紅利積點:9 點
相關商品
商品簡介
目次

商品簡介

本書以Microsoft SQL Server 2016中文版為平臺,系統介紹SQL Server 2016基礎、實驗和綜合應用等內容。 本書在介紹數據庫的基礎知識後,系統介紹數據庫創建、表的創建和操作、數據庫的查詢和視圖、T-SQL語言、索引和數據完整性、存儲過程和觸發器、備份與恢復、系統安全管理、事務鎖定和自動化管理等。實驗通過教程實例訓練SQL Server基本操作和基本命令。綜合應用以PHP、Java EE、Visual C#、Python和ASP.NET(含Ajax)等平臺開發環境的構建的基礎,系統介紹對SQL Server學生成績數據庫的典型操作方法,同時實現學生成績管理系統精心設計的功能,更方便教學和學生模仿。 本書配有教學課件和配套的客戶端/SQL Server 2016應用系統數據庫和所有源程序文件。需要者請到華信教育資源網(http://www.hxedu.com.cn)免費註冊下載,本書配套視頻教學文件,通過掃描對應位置的二維碼播放。 本書是普通高等教育“十一五”國家級規劃教材,可作為大學本科、高職高專數據庫課程教材和社會培訓教材,也可供廣大數據庫應用開發人員參考。

本書以Microsoft SQL Server 2016中文版為平臺,系統介紹SQL Server 2016基礎、實驗和綜合應用等內容。 本書在介紹數據庫的基礎知識後,系統介紹數據庫創建、表的創建和操作、數據庫的查詢和視圖、T-SQL語言、索引和數據完整性、存儲過程和觸發器、備份與恢復、系統安全管理、事務鎖定和自動化管理等。實驗通過教程實例訓練SQL Server基本操作和基本命令。綜合應用以PHP、Java EE、Visual C#、Python和ASP.NET(含Ajax)等平臺開發環境的構建的基礎,系統介紹對SQL Server學生成績數據庫的典型操作方法,同時實現學生成績管理系統精心設計的功能,更方便教學和學生模仿。 本書配有教學課件和配套的客戶端/SQL Server 2016應用系統數據庫和所有源程序文件。需要者請到華信教育資源網(http://www.hxedu.com.cn)免費註冊下載,本書配套視頻教學文件,通過掃描對應位置的二維碼播放。 本書是普通高等教育“十一五”國家級規劃教材,可作為大學本科、高職高專數據庫課程教材和社會培訓教材,也可供廣大數據庫應用開發人員參考。

目次

目 錄
第1部分 實 用 教 程

第0章 數據庫基礎 1
0.1 數據庫基本概念 1
0.2 數據庫設計 4
第1章 SQL Server 2016簡介 7
1.1 SQL Server 2016服務器組件和管理
工具 7
1.2 SQL Server 2016的安裝 9
1.2.1 SQL Server 2016安裝準備 9
1.2.2 下載並安裝JDK 10
1.2.3 SQL Server 2016及其組件
安裝 14
1.2.4 安裝SQL Server Management
Studio(SSMS) 20
1.3 SQL Server 2016操作 22
1.3.1 採用SQL Server Management
Studio(SSMS)操作 22
1.3.2 採用其他工具操作SQL Server
2016 24
第2章 數據庫創建 27
2.1 SQL Server數據庫及其數據庫對象 27
2.2 以命令方式創建數據庫 29
2.2.1 創建數據庫 29
2.2.2 修改數據庫 33
2.2.3 刪除數據庫 36
第3章表的創建和操作 37
3.1 表結構和數據類型 37
3.1.1 表和表結構 37
3.1.2 數據類型 38
3.1.3 表結構設計 41
3.2 以命令方式創建表 43
3.2.1 創建表 43
3.2.2 修改表結構 45
3.2.3 刪除表 47
3.3 以命令方式操作表數據 47
3.3.1 插入記錄 47
3.3.2 修改記錄 49
3.3.3 刪除記錄 50
3.4 為查詢準備數據 51
第4章 數據庫的查詢和視圖 52
4.1 數據庫的查詢 52
4.1.1 選擇查詢結果輸出列 52
4.1.2 選擇查詢條件 57
4.1.3 指定查詢對象 62
4.1.4 連接 64
4.1.5 指定查詢結果分組方法 68
4.1.6 指定查詢結果分組後篩選
條件 69
4.1.7 指定查詢結果排序 70
4.1.8 SELECT語句的其他語法 71
4.2 視圖 74
4.2.1 視圖概念 74
4.2.2 創建視圖 75
4.2.3 更新視圖 78
4.2.4 修改視圖的定義 80
4.2.5 刪除視圖 81
第5章 遊標 82
5.1 聲明￿標 82
5.2 打開￿標 84
5.3 讀取數據 85
5.4 關閉和刪除￿標 87
第6章 T-SQL語言 89
6.1 常量、變量與用戶定義類型 89
6.1.1 常量 89
6.1.2 用戶定義類型 90
6.1.3 變量 92
6.2 運算符與表達式 96
6.3 流程控制語句 100
6.4 系統內置函數 105
6.4.1 系統內置函數介紹 105
6.4.2 常用系統標量函數 106
6.5 用戶定義函數 112
6.5.1 標量函數 112
6.5.2 內嵌表值函數 114
6.5.3 用戶定義函數的刪除 116
第7章 索引和完整性 118
7.1 索引 118
7.1.1 索引的分類 118
7.1.2 索引的創建 119
7.1.3 重建索引 120
7.1.4 索引的刪除 121
7.2 數據完整性 121
7.2.1 創建實體完整性 123
7.2.2 創建域完整性 125
7.2.3 創建參照完整性 128
第8章 存儲過程和觸發器 132
8.1 存儲過程 132
8.1.1 存儲過程的類型 132
8.1.2 存儲過程的創建與執行 133
8.1.3 存儲過程的修改 137
8.1.4 存儲過程的刪除 138
8.2 觸發器 138
8.2.1 觸發器的類型 138
8.2.2 觸發器的創建 139
8.2.3 觸發器的修改 145
8.2.4 觸發器的刪除 145
第9章 備份與恢復 147
9.1 備份與恢復概述 147
9.1.1 數據庫備份的概念 147
9.1.2 數據庫恢復的概念 149
9.2 數據庫備份 149
9.2.1 創建備份設備 150
9.2.2 以命令方式備份數據庫 151
9.3 數據庫恢復 154
9.4 附加數據庫和數據庫複製 157
第10章 系統安全管理 159
10.1 SQL Server 2016的安全機制 159
10.1.1 SQL Server 身份驗證模式 159
10.1.2 SQL Server安全性機制 160
10.1.3 SQL Server數據庫安全驗證
過程 160
10.2 建立和管理用戶賬戶 161
10.2.1 以界面方式管理用戶賬戶 161
10.2.2 以命令方式管理用戶賬戶 165
10.3 角色管理 167
10.3.1 固定服務器角色 167
10.3.2 固定數據庫角色 169
10.3.3 自定義數據庫角色 172
10.3.4 應用程序角色 174
10.4 數據庫權限的管理 175
10.4.1 授予權限 175
10.4.2 拒絕權限 178
10.4.3 撤銷權限 179
10.5 數據庫架構的定義和使用 180
10.5.1 以界面方式創建架構 180
10.5.2 以命令方式創建架構 182
第11章 其他概念 184
11.1 事務 184
11.2 鎖定 189
11.3 自動化管理 190


第2部分 實 驗

實驗1 SQL Server 2016環境 193
實驗2 創建數據庫和表 195
實驗3 表數據的插入、修改和刪除 197
實驗3.1 表結構的創建 197
實驗3.2 表記錄的插入、修改和刪除 199
實驗4 數據庫的查詢和視圖 203
實驗4.1 數據庫的查詢 203
實驗4.2 視圖的使用 208
實驗5 T-SQL編程 210
實驗6 索引和數據完整性的使用 214
實驗6.1 索引 214
實驗6.2 完整性 215
實驗7 存儲過程和觸發器的使用 218
實驗7.1 存儲過程 218
實驗7.2 觸發器 220
實驗8 備份恢復與導入導出 223
實驗8.1 數據庫的備份 223
實驗8.2 數據庫的恢復 224
實驗9 數據庫的安全性 225
實驗9.1 數據庫用戶的管理 225
實驗9.2 服務器角色的應用 226
實驗9.3 數據庫權限管理 227
實驗10 SQL Server與XML 229

第3部分 習 題

習題0 233
習題1 233
習題2 234
習題3 235
習題4 236
習題5 237
習題6 238
習題7 239
習題8 240
習題9 240
習題10 241
習題11 242

第4部分 SQL Server 2016綜合應用

實習0 創建實習數據庫 243
實習0.1 創建數據庫及其對象 243
實習0.2 應用系統功能和界面 253
實習0.3 應用系統的數據接口 255
實習1 PHP 7/SQL Server 2016學生成績
管理系統 257
實習1.1 PHP開發平臺搭建 257
實習1.1.1 創建PHP環境 257
實習1.1.2 Eclipse安裝與配置 263
實習1.2 PHP開發入門 264
實習1.2.1 PHP項目的建立 264
實習1.2.2 PHP項目的運行 265
實習1.2.3 PHP連接SQL Server
2016 267
實習1.3 系統主頁設計 269
實習1.3.1 主界面 269
實習1.3.2 功能導航 270
實習1.4 學生管理 271
實習1.4.1 界面設計 271
實習1.4.2 功能實現 273
實習1.5 成績管理 275
實習1.5.1 界面設計 275
實習1.5.2 功能實現 278
實習2 Java EE 7/SQL Server 2016學生成績
管理系統 280
實習2.1 Java EE開發平臺搭建 280
實習2.1.1 安裝軟件 280
實習2.1.2 環境整合 283
實習2.2 創建Struts 2項目 285
實習2.2.1 創建Java EE項目 285
實習2.2.2 加載Struts 2包 286
實習2.2.3 連接SQL Server 2016 288
實習2.3 系統主頁設計 290
實習2.3.1 創建JSP環境 290
實習2.3.2 功能導航 291
實習2.3.3 部署項目 293
實習2.4 學生管理 294
實習2.4.1 界面設計 294
實習2.4.2 功能實現 297
實習2.5 成績管理 302
實習2.5.1 界面設計 302
實習2.5.2 功能實現 304
實習3 ASP.NET 4.x/SQL Server 2016學生
成績管理系統 308
實習3.1 創建ASP.NET項目 308
?VII?
實習3.1.1 ASP.NET項目的建立 308
實習3.1.2 ASP.NET 4連接SQL
Server 2016 308
實習3.2 Ajax技術應用 309
實習3.2.1 功能需求 309
實習3.2.2 技術實現 310
實習3.3 學生管理 314
實習3.3.1 界面設計 314
實習3.3.2 功能實現 316
實習3.4 成績管理 321
實習3.4.1 界面設計 321
實習3.4.2 功能實現 323
實習4 Visual C# 2017/SQL Server 2016學生
成績管理系統 330
實習4.1 創建Visual C#項目 330
實習4.2 系統主界面設計 330
實習4.2.1 總體佈局 330
實習4.2.2 詳細設計 3

您曾經瀏覽過的商品

購物須知

大陸出版品因裝訂品質及貨運條件與台灣出版品落差甚大,除封面破損、內頁脫落等較嚴重的狀態,其餘商品將正常出貨。

特別提醒:部分書籍附贈之內容(如音頻mp3或影片dvd等)已無實體光碟提供,需以QR CODE 連結至當地網站註冊“並通過驗證程序”,方可下載使用。

無現貨庫存之簡體書,將向海外調貨:
海外有庫存之書籍,等候約45個工作天;
海外無庫存之書籍,平均作業時間約60個工作天,然不保證確定可調到貨,尚請見諒。

為了保護您的權益,「三民網路書店」提供會員七日商品鑑賞期(收到商品為起始日)。

若要辦理退貨,請在商品鑑賞期內寄回,且商品必須是全新狀態與完整包裝(商品、附件、發票、隨貨贈品等)否則恕不接受退貨。

優惠價:87 308
海外經銷商無庫存,到貨日平均30天至45天

暢銷榜

客服中心

收藏

會員專區